Novice in Zenithal Duel is the fifth part of the Trailblaze Continuance chapter Finest Duel Under the Pristine Blue (II). It automatically begins after completing The Red Warcry.

Steps[]

  1. Board the Skysplitter and participate in the Wardance
  2. Arrive at the Skysplitter's security checkpoint
  3. Head toward the contestant hall
  4. Prod around to find out how strong the other contestants are
  5. Head toward the Skysplitter's upper deck
    • (Optional) Continue to probe into how strong the other contestants are
  6. Reach the Skysplitter's upper deck

UI Trailblaze Continuance Mission Description

General Huaiyan tasks March 7th and Yunli with boarding the Skysplitter and participating in the Wardance. Apart from striving for victory in the arena, they must also take up the responsibility of defending the arena against potential crises. However, the young swordswoman who will be making her debut can't help but feel anxious at such a prospect...
